The renewal of our three-year agreement with Torvane Materials has been assessed in detail. Proposed terms include a 4.2% unit-price increase, partially offset by improved volume rebates and extended payment terms of sixty days. Sensitivity analysis indicates a net annual cost impact of under 1% on the Meridia product line, assuming stable demand. Legal has flagged no material changes to liability clauses. We recommend approval, subject to the conditions outlined in the confidential note below.

confidential, yawip-bahif: Zorokox Partners plans to lower the Casax list price by 28.0 percent in April. The board signed off on a budget of $271.0 million for Project Juldor. The renewal with Pelokox Partners closes at $410.1 million a year, 3.4 percent below the last contract. Project Pelok slips by a full year because of the audit delay.

## Partner SFTP Drop — Marlowe Freight

Files land nightly between 02:00–03:30 UTC in the inbound drop. Watcher job `marlowe-ingest` picks them up; if nothing arrives by 04:00, the Quillhook alert fires. Do NOT re-request files from Marlowe before checking the quarantine folder — malformed headers get parked there silently. Retries are safe; ingest is idempotent on file checksum. Rotation of the drop credentials is quarterly, owned by platform. Full escalation steps and contacts are on the runbook page.

dashboard of taduf-tahof = https://confluence.tolvaqlabs.internal/browse/browse/display/f01240ca

## Support

All third-party fonts in Tindersketch are vendored under `assets/fonts/` with license files alongside. Do not fetch fonts at build time; the vendoring script pins checksums. Updates go through `tools/vendor_fonts.sh` and require a checksum diff in the PR. License questions, checksum mismatches, or provenance concerns for any vendored font should be sent to the address below.

pager mailbox: druwyn@norvaio.corp